Dove Bird Tattoo

Dove Bird Tattoo

Doves have prestige in Christianity as being referred to as the story of Noah and the arc. They are known for a peaceful and calm nature and are considered as a symbol of purity, love, and innocence. Christians also use it to symbolize starting over a new life.

The one who has turned into a new leaf with a more positive attitude towards life has the best choice of dove tattoo to demonstrate his new beginning. A medium-size dove tattoo looks great over the shoulder, or chest (close to the heart from where the desire begins). Ask your artist to add details with white ink over a black base to make an iconic design.

Phoenix Bird Tattoo

Phoenix Bird Tattoo

 

Phoenix from the origin is a mythical bird that describes as a ‘bird of the sun’. Because it arise from its own ashes, therefore, known to symbolize the idea of eternity, resilience, and rebirth. It also has a unique status in different cultures and is strongly believed to be a source of power and strength to the ones who have survived hard times.

If you had been faced some kind of trauma or incident that transformed you into a stronger person then Phoenix will be the bird of your choice. Although it goes well in a large piece you can also have a minimal Phoenix design. The bold and vibrant colors while beautifying your tattoo also make it intense and desirable.

Eagle Bird Tattoo

Eagle Bird Tattoo

Wisdom, freedom, patriotism, and strength are the meanings interpreted by an eagle tattoo and make this bird a popular choice for men’s tattoo. In American culture, it symbolizes patriotism while in Eastern some view it as a bird who idolizes courage and freedom.

All the details a tattooist can make in its feathers, tail, and wings make the tattoo more aesthetic and appealing. Your forearm or back can beautifully hold this eagle tattoo.

Owl Bird Tattoo

Owl Bird Tattoo

For a long time, owls were misguided as an evil bird or a symbol of bad luck, particularly in the Middle Eastern Cultures. But now this perception has been changed much. People generally associate it with knowledge and wisdom. Being a nocturnal bird, it is also used to manifest deepness, magic, and mystery.

Dard inks make it looks more pleasing and the big, round eyes are the most visible feature of this tattoo which makes it more prominent in your biceps or thigh.

Hummingbird Tattoo

Hummingbird Tattoo

If you are a happy soul who loves to spread joy and happiness among others then a hummingbird Tattoo can be the right choice for body art. This bird is known for love, joy, and energy. As it is a small bird so you can sketch it out anywhere on your neck, chest, inner arm, hands, or foot. Moreover, adding rich, vibrant colors or not will be your one choice.
